Can't speak for the more recent models. Some may be manufactured by Peugeot and sold with Toyota badge but the older models are bomb proof.
Buy one with a 2.5 D4D engine. Code 2KD - FTV. The timing belt runs off the fuel pump and can be renewed in one hour.
As easy as taking apart a TX200.
Resetting the timing belt warning light being the most complicated part of the job.
